>>1812548I also leave manual drift off. Tried online tutorials, but agree (>>1812616) that it's difficult to manual drift. Default drift doesn't hurt ability to compete in ranked because the game algorithm matches you against players of similar skill. But it will reduce scores, especially on tracks where it's hard to hold combo.Smart steering tries to pull me away from track shortcuts sometimes so I just always leave it off. Auto item is a personal preference, but having it on drops your defense while items load so it should be turned off for battles and multiplayer.

I'll start ranked after collecting those on both accounts, and yet I'll still have more time afterward for ranked today than last tuesday.>>1825371I like tour's berlin march so much more than 8 deluxe's because the synth is more aggressive. maybe if it ever reaches world someday they'll improve on it.>>1825477I didalso for reference, when falling through water, there are three ways to prevent losing combo:1. of course, use an instant-effect item or time a delayed-effect item in advance. hitting another driver gives you the most combo time.2. charge a mini turbo with autodrift before falling, then release it in mid-fall3. swipe up to nosedive the kart so it lands earlier to try to interact with whatever's down there or even start a new drift asap. I don't have any level 8 high end gliders so completing a mini turbo that late after a long drop never works for me, but for all I know it might work with +30% combo timing.good luck all
